After comparing prices on booking websites, we finally chose to book at Just Sleep Kaohsiung Zhongzheng through Trip Moments. The front desk staff provided excellent service when we called with questions, checked in, checked out, and stored our luggage. The entrance to the underground parking lot behind the building is relatively small, with a faded canopy and small lettering, making it easy to miss, especially with nearby parked cars. After calling the front desk and following their directions, we quickly found the parking entrance. There are limited parking spaces on B1, but we arrived early and managed to secure a spot. The second-floor lounge offers coffee and snacks, and there is a gym and laundry facilities with free detergent, which made doing laundry convenient during our two-night stay. However, the dryer requires a $10 fee. The room was very clean, with a good layout. The mattress, quilt, and pillows were very comfortable, and complimentary drinks and snacks were provided. We stayed in different room types over the two days. The first night was a four-person room with two double beds and a bidet toilet, while the second night was a two-person room with two single beds but no bidet toilet. Breakfast was decent, but on the first morning at 6:30 AM, we encountered a large tour group, making the food area crowded and the flow of people less organized. Overall, it was a very pleasant stay.

Meinong, a suburb of Kaohsiung, was once selected as one of Taiwan's top ten tourist towns. During the Japanese colonial period, the Japanese army built a power plant here, giving it a distinctly Japanese feel. With 90% of the population being Hakka, Meinong boasts numerous Hakka cultural attractions, such as Yong'an Old Street and the Meinong Folk Village, offering a glimpse into the authentic Hakka culture. Beyond Hakka culture, visitors can also enjoy the stunning lake and mountain scenery. Meinong Lake is Kaohsiung's second largest lake, boasting a lakeside walking and bicycle trail lined with red-flowered cypress, bald cypress, and water willow. In the surrounding farmland, during the winter when crops are not cultivated, various flowers are planted for free viewing by visitors. The Meinong Cultural and Creative Center, located on Yong'an Old Street, was converted from the century-old Meinong Police Station. It is the only remaining official building from the Japanese colonial era in the Meinong area. Its Baroque exterior and Japanese-style interior create a unique blend of Japanese and Western elements. Cradle Café in the Cultural and Creative Center offers light meals, desserts, coffee, and drinks. -The Meinong Hakka Museum showcases the life, customs, and history of the Hakka people. There's also the Meinong Library, where the curtains are decorated with Hakka-dyed fabrics, reflecting Meinong's rustic yet Japanese style. -Meinong's delicious food is also a must-try. Meinong's rice noodles are renowned far and wide and are a must-try.
